MGU tops list of best Indian varsities in polymer science

In a significant achievement, Mahatma Gandhi University, Kottayam has topped the list of the best universities in India in the field of polymer science for the year 2022-23. University of the Third Age, an International movement launched at MGU

The University of the Third Age (U3A), a programme that seeks to guide those aged above 55 years into a happy third phase of their life, began at the Mahatma Gandhi University (MGU), Kottayam, on March 11.   University Vice-Chancellor Sabu Thomas inaugurated the programme at a function at The Assembly hall.
